"Journeys of the Heart" series books 1-3 are short gentle romance novella's set in the victorian era and includes: "There's More Than Fear, Beloved" - A secret from Marisa's past keeps her from trusting men, or from believing in love. Her unknowing family try to thrust her into marriage. Grant Dawson is the only one who knows her secret, but will she let go of her fear and trust in his love? "Since the Day I Met You" - Delphine has always been a tomboy kind of girl, bold spoken, reckless and adventurous. Afraid to lose the man she loves, she sets out to reform herself, hoping she can earn his love by becoming a "proper young lady" whom he can admire. "Forget Me Not, O Gentle Stranger" - When Emily Shaw learns the extent of her father's gambling debts, she finds help and comfort from an honorable stranger. Can she win his heart?
